choeras
Latin
Etymology
Borrowed from Ancient Greek χοιρᾰ́ς (khoirás).
Pronunciation
- (Classical) IPA(key): /ˈkʰoe̯.ras/
Inflection
Third declension.
Case | Singular | Plural |
---|---|---|
Nominative | choeras | choeradēs |
Genitive | choeradis | choeradum |
Dative | choeradī | choeradibus |
Accusative | choeradem | choeradēs |
Ablative | choerade | choeradibus |
Vocative | choeras | choeradēs |
